javascript - 如何在悬停时制作圆 Angular ?

标签 javascript jquery css wordpress rounded-corners

我正在为 wordpress 制作主题。我的导航栏像苹果网站一样有圆 Angular 。我想给它添加一个悬停样式,但我不能让它悬停在圆 Angular 上,就像苹果的导航栏那样。我正在使用大图像作为背景并使用 wordpress 3 的菜单系统。那么,如何将鼠标悬停在栏上的第一个和最后一个元素上?感谢您的帮助。

最佳答案

使用 javascript,您可以选择和更改任何您想要的,但如果您只想使用 css,则必须将 :hover 应用于所有按钮子元素的父级,以便您可以使用 css 选择所有子元素。但是,这不包括旧版本的 IE,因为它们不支持 :hovera 标签以外的元素上。

例子:

.button:hover {
  // 
}
.button:hover .main_section {
  // change to main section of button on hover
}
.button:hover .left_part {
  // change to left side on hover
}
.button:hover .right_part {
  // change to right side on hover
}

关于javascript - 如何在悬停时制作圆 Angular ?,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/5220174/

相关文章:

javascript - 在音频元素中选择

javascript - ASP NET 自定义验证器错误消息未显示

javascript - 当我使用 XMLHttpRequest 和 SAS 将图像放入 azure blob 存储时格式错误

javascript - 为什么在填写所有字段之前我的提交按钮会重新启用?

javascript - 当 JavaScript 中的类没有默认构造函数时,如何扩展它?

javascript - 如何使用自定义高度图表,如图所示?

javascript - 比较样式属性顺序无关的两个 HTML 元素

javascript - 单击 href 删除行 (TR)

javascript - 如何使用id获取 anchor 标签的背景图片url

html - 将图像 div 与其旁边的文本 div 的垂直中心对齐